The sweet and savory combination from the juicy summer fruits alongside the salty cheese and the mild bite from the onion- everything just works. And mint is the ideal compliment to it all. The Watermelon Peach Salad especially paired beautifully with the local sparkling wine from Riverbench that was served.
This Watermelon Peach Salad also appears on my summer catering menu so I make it often for dinner parties- between the vibrant colors and the delicate balance of flavors, it’s always a sure bet. Best of all, it barely requires a dressing. Just a simple drizzle of olive oil and a squeeze of lemon juice is all that’s required to enhance the flavors.

Watermelon Peach Salad with Mint and Ricotta Salata
Squeeze every last ounce of goodness out of summer with this Watermelon Peach Salad, accented with fresh mint, savory ricotta salata and shaved red onions.
Ingredients
- 2 cups watermelon cut into cubes
- 1 cup peaches sliced
- 1/4 cup red onion thinly sliced
- 1/4 cup ricotta salata shaved
- 2 tablespoons fresh mint leaves
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- Flaky sea salt
- Lemon juice
Instructions
Toss watermelon, peaches, red onion, ricotta salata and mint together in a salad bowl. Drizzle with olive oil. Garnish with flaky sea salt and finish with a squeeze of lemon juice.
